Are the Museums and Historical Sights Better in Bilbao or Bari?

Bilbao
Bari

Plenty of people visit the excellent sights and museums in both Bilbao and Bari.

Visitors can fill many days exploring the museums and attractions around Bilbao. A favorite museum in town is the popular Guggenheim Museum. From its iconic building to the unique exhibits, this is a must-see stop during your visit. Other highlights around town include the Museo de Bellas Artes de Bilbao, the Museo Vasco, as well as the city's unique bridges.

Bari offers many unique museums, sights, and landmarks that will make for a memorable trip. The city is filled with historical sights and archeological ruins. San Nicola is the main basilica in town and a popular tourist sight. The Castello is also a highlight, as is San Sabino.


Is the Food Better in Bilbao or Bari? Which Destination has the Best Restaurants?

Bilbao
Bari

Bari is an amazing port city to visit for its restaurant scene. However, Bilbao is not a culinary destination.

Eat your way through Bari, as it has many local or world renowned restaurants to choose from. It's off-the-beaten-path vibe means that you won't find the overpriced tourist restaurants that have taken over more touristy cities. Instead you'll find locally owned pasta shops that cater to the town's residents. You can taste authentic Pugliese cuisine, which is centered around wheat and olive oil. Orecchiette is the local pasta and seafood is one of the most common staples.

Bilbao is not a culinary destination. The food scene is among the best in Spain. The city has several world renowned restaurants, including a few Michelin-starred restaurants, but there are also smaller eateries that cater to the locals and tourists alike. Make sure you try the pintxos, which are small dishes that are the Basque region's answer to tapas. Many include seafood and are cooked with olive oil and garlic.

Is Bilbao or Bari Better for its Old Town?

Bilbao
Bari

Bari is well known for its old town. Also, Bilbao is still popular, but not quite as popular for its historic old town charm.

There are many historical things to see in the old town of Bari. The old town is filled with historic sights, mazelike streets, and great food. It's pedestrian-only and, because Bari is not as popular with tourists, it holds on to its authentic charm.

Bilbao has an old town worth visiting. The old town, often called Casco Viejo, is filled with historic architecture, great local bars, and some interesting shopping.

Is Bilbao or Bari Better for Families?

Bilbao
Bari

Bari is well known for its family-friendly activities. Also, Bilbao is still popular, but not quite as popular for its kid-friendly activities.

Bari is a very kid-friendly port city. There are historical sites and castles to explore as well as the fun-filled Miragica amusement park. There's also an impressive underground city that will spark the kid's imagination. Other fun activities include visiting the nearby beaches, taking a kayak tour, or wandering around the old town.

Bilbao offers lots of family activities. The city offers some great museums such as the Guggenheim Museum. Families will also enjoy taking a ride of the Artxander Funicular, and exploring Mercado de la Ribera. You can also enjoy walking around Park Abandoibarra and exploring the creative sculptures.

Which place is cheaper, Bari or Bilbao?

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ations.

The average daily cost (per person) in Bilbao is €137, while the average daily cost in Bari is €113.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. What follows is a categorical breakdown of travel costs for Bilbao and Bari in more detail.

When is the best time to visit Bilbao or Bari?

Both places have a temperate climate with four distinct seasons. As both cities are in the northern hemisphere, summer is in July and winter is in January.

Should I visit Bilbao or Bari in the Summer?

Both Bari and Bilbao during the summer are popular places to visit. The summer months attract visitors to Bilbao because of the city activities and the family-friendly experiences. Furthermore, the beaches, the city activities, and the family-friendly experiences are the main draw to Bari this time of year.

In the summer, Bilbao is cooler than Bari. Typically, the summer temperatures in Bilbao in July average around 20°C (68°F), and Bari averages at about 25°C (76°F).

In Bari, it's very sunny this time of the year. In the summer, Bilbao often gets less sunshine than Bari. Bilbao gets 188 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Bari receives 336 hours of full sun.

Bilbao usually gets more rain in July than Bari. Bilbao gets 51 mm (2 in) of rain, while Bari receives 9 mm (0.3 in) of rain this time of the year.

Should I visit Bilbao or Bari in the Autumn?

The autumn attracts plenty of travelers to both Bilbao and Bari. The city's sights and attractions and the shopping scene are the main draw to Bilbao this time of year. Furthermore, many travelers come to Bari for the city's sights and attractions and the shopping scene.

In October, Bilbao is generally cooler than Bari. Daily temperatures in Bilbao average around 16°C (62°F), and Bari fluctuates around 18°C (65°F).

Bilbao usually receives less sunshine than Bari during autumn. Bilbao gets 125 hours of sunny skies, while Bari receives 178 hours of full sun in the autumn.

Bilbao gets a good bit of rain this time of year. In October, Bilbao usually receives more rain than Bari. Bilbao gets 111 mm (4.4 in) of rain, while Bari receives 70 mm (2.7 in) of rain each month for the autumn.

Should I visit Bilbao or Bari in the Winter?

The winter brings many poeple to Bilbao as well as Bari. Many travelers come to Bilbao for the museums and the shopping scene. Additionally, many visitors come to Bari in the winter for the museums, the shopping scene, and the cuisine.

Bilbao is around the same temperature as Bari in the winter. The daily temperature in Bilbao averages around 9°C (48°F) in January, and Bari fluctuates around 10°C (49°F).

In the winter, Bilbao often gets less sunshine than Bari. Bilbao gets 77 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Bari receives 110 hours of full sun.

Bilbao receives a lot of rain in the winter. Bilbao usually gets more rain in January than Bari. Bilbao gets 130 mm (5.1 in) of rain, while Bari receives 62 mm (2.4 in) of rain this time of the year.

Should I visit Bilbao or Bari in the Spring?

Both Bari and Bilbao are popular destinations to visit in the spring with plenty of activities. Many visitors come to Bilbao in the spring for the activities around the city. Also, most visitors come to Bari for the beaches and the activities around the city during these months.

In the spring, Bilbao is cooler than Bari. Typically, the spring temperatures in Bilbao in April average around 12°C (54°F), and Bari averages at about 14°C (58°F).

It's quite sunny in Bari. Bilbao usually receives less sunshine than Bari during spring. Bilbao gets 117 hours of sunny skies, while Bari receives 203 hours of full sun in the spring.

It's quite rainy in Bilbao. In April, Bilbao usually receives more rain than Bari. Bilbao gets 129 mm (5.1 in) of rain, while Bari receives 32 mm (1.3 in) of rain each month for the spring.

Typical Weather for Bari and Bilbao

Bilbao Bari
Temp (°C) Rain (mm) Temp (°C) Rain (mm)
Jan 9°C (48°F) 130 mm (5.1 in) 10°C (49°F) 62 mm (2.4 in)
Feb 10°C (50°F) 108 mm (4.3 in) 10°C (50°F) 61 mm (2.4 in)
Mar 11°C (51°F) 100 mm (3.9 in) 12°C (53°F) 65 mm (2.6 in)
Apr 12°C (54°F) 129 mm (5.1 in) 14°C (58°F) 32 mm (1.3 in)
May 15°C (59°F) 92 mm (3.6 in) 18°C (64°F) 25 mm (1 in)
Jun 18°C (64°F) 65 mm (2.6 in) 22°C (71°F) 20 mm (0.8 in)
Jul 20°C (68°F) 51 mm (2 in) 25°C (76°F) 9 mm (0.3 in)
Aug 20°C (68°F) 89 mm (3.5 in) 25°C (76°F) 26 mm (1 in)
Sep 19°C (66°F) 75 mm (3 in) 22°C (72°F) 47 mm (1.9 in)
Oct 16°C (62°F) 111 mm (4.4 in) 18°C (65°F) 70 mm (2.7 in)
Nov 12°C (54°F) 152 mm (6 in) 14°C (57°F) 75 mm (3 in)
Dec 10°C (50°F) 135 mm (5.3 in) 11°C (52°F) 67 mm (2.6 in)
